MACo’s Half-Day in Annapolis
October 23, 2013
10:00 am – 2:30 am
Would you like to know how to read a bill and follow its progress during the Session?
Have you ever wondered what the appropriate protocol is for testifying before a committee?
Are you curious about the fiscal note requests you receive about proposed legislation?
Do you know how a policy committee and a budget committee differ?
Or do you simply need to know the logistics of maneuvering the streets (parking), halls (getting in and out of buildings), and committees (where to sit and sign up to testify) in Annapolis?
If so, this half-day training is for you!
Whether you are a complete novice or a seasoned veteran, MACo hopes this event will provide you with practical information. The training will be held on Wednesday, October 23, beginning at 10 am in the MACo Office. Morning discussions will focus on the legislative process, MACo’s bill review and hearing process, and the fiscal note process. A short guided walking tour highlights some of the historical and practical areas of interest within the government complex. Afternoon discussions will be held in a committee room and focus on budget and bill hearing protocols and tips on testifying. Please view the tentative agenda for more information.
